How they compare

Guyana currently reports 1.34 terawatt-hours against 1.09 terawatt-hours in Equatorial Guinea, a difference of 0.25 terawatt-hours.

That makes Guyana's figure about 1.2 times Equatorial Guinea's.

Across all 25 years both countries report, Guyana has been ahead every year.

Equatorial Guinea ranks 132nd and Guyana ranks 130th of 209 countries.

Guyana has averaged higher in every one of the 3 decades both report.

Head to head by decade

Decade Equatorial Guinea Guyana Difference Ahead
2000s 0.092 terawatt-hours 0.787 terawatt-hours 0.695 terawatt-hours Guyana
2010s 0.675 terawatt-hours 0.991 terawatt-hours 0.316 terawatt-hours Guyana
2020s 1.02 terawatt-hours 1.23 terawatt-hours 0.212 terawatt-hours Guyana

Averages of every year both report within each decade.
